Cesny: “I was afraid I would die in the Sporting game”
Wojciech Szczesny experienced a difficult moment last season when he had to pull out of the game against Sporting due to chest pain. The Poland Juventus goalkeeper admitted in an interview that he feared for his life.
Wojciech Szczesny was one of Juventus’ “strongest moments” last season, coming at home against Sporting in the Europa League quarter-finals.
Specifically, just before the end of the first part of the game, when the Polish goalkeeper felt discomfort in his chest and was forced to leave with the help of his teammates. The pain subsided a little later, but he himself did not live to forget the fear he felt, although several months have passed since then.
“I really thought I was going to die, it was scary. After passing a teammate, I felt like my heart would explode in my chest.”
During a corner I told Milik that I was bad, but the opponents had already taken it. The chest pains were excruciating and even today I don’t know what happened, maybe there was something wrong with the chest or the spine.” Sessny emphasized in an interview with “Canal Plus Sport Polonia” and then speak in the best terms about Massimo Allegri.
“We’re very friends, I respect him because he can tell me things that nobody else would tell me. We’ve also been neighbors since I’ve been in Turin, so I’d say he’s a good friend of mine.”
When asked to speak about his international career and when he will retire, he said: “My retirement from the Polish national team is approaching, I’ve played more than I expected.”
I’ll stop when I feel like I can’t give 100%, but I’ll say it when it happens because right now I don’t have the slightest desire to say goodbye.”
